IBSET — Set bitIBSET returns the value of I with the bit at position
POS set to one.
Fortran 95 and later, has overloads that are GNU extensions
Elemental function
RESULT = IBSET(I, POS)
| I | The type shall be INTEGER. |
| POS | The type shall be INTEGER. |
The return value is of type INTEGER and of the same kind as
I.
| Name | Argument | Return type | Standard |
IBSET(A) | INTEGER A | INTEGER | Fortran 95 and later |
BBSET(A) | INTEGER(1) A | INTEGER(1) | GNU extension |
IIBSET(A) | INTEGER(2) A | INTEGER(2) | GNU extension |
JIBSET(A) | INTEGER(4) A | INTEGER(4) | GNU extension |
KIBSET(A) | INTEGER(8) A | INTEGER(8) | GNU extension |
